Information for pre registration optometrists who have recently qualified
Newly-qualified AOP membership
Once you’ve passed your OSCEs, the insurance provided as part of the AOP’s free student membership is no longer valid. The GOC requires you to have adequate insurance cover in place and, by upgrading your membership to the newly-qualified grade, you will meet these requirements.
AOP membership is designed to support you and your career. By continuing your membership, you will have access to:
- Full AOP member benefits, including employment and regulatory advice*, CPD and free education
- Professional insurance cover
- Discounted membership rates for the remainder of the year in which you qualify, and the following year. After this period, the Full or concessionary membership fees will apply.
*If you’re joining for the first time and require assistance you must inform us during the declaration step of your application as pre-existing issues may not be covered.
Eligibility
To qualify for the discounted newly-qualified membership rate, you must:
- Be qualifying for the first time
- Not have previously qualified in another country (otherwise Full or concessionary membership fees will apply)

Membership fees
The newly-qualified membership fee for 2026 is £467.00.
Your qualification date determines how much you will pay for the remainder of the year, as fees are pro-rated depending on the when you join/upgrade. All memberships start from the first day of your selected month until 31 December and renewal notices for the following year are sent in November.
You can choose to pay by credit/debit card or set up a direct debit.
